Q. Explain about Virtual Circuit Switching?
Virtual Circuit Switching
- All packets belong to a message (or) session is preserved.
- Single route is selected between source/destination.
- All packets obtain that route to reach destination.
- It requires a call setup to establish a virtual circuit. (Either permanent or switched type)
- Uses virtual circuit identifier for routing.
